Logan/Palco will head out on the road to square off against the Western Plains Bobcats at 6:00 p.m. on Tuesday. Logan/Palco is hoping to put an end to a five-game streak of away losses dating back to last season.
Last Friday, it was a hard-fought contest, but Logan/Palco had to settle for a 39-37 defeat against Golden Plains. While losing is never fun, Logan/Palco can't take it too hard given the team's big disadvantage in MaxPreps' Kansas basketball rankings (they are ranked 307th, while Golden Plains is ranked 136th).
The loss doesn't tell the whole story though, as several players had good games. One of the most active was Ansley Delimont, who scored 11 points. Another player making a difference was Cydnee Ryder, who scored 12 points.
Meanwhile, Western Plains' recent rough patch got a bit rougher last Friday after their sixth straight loss. They fell just short of Heartland Christian by a score of 43-40.
Despite the defeat, Western Plains saw an underclassman step up: Madelyn Kraus dropped a double-double on 25 points and ten rebounds. As a matter of fact, that's the most points Kraus has scored all season. The team also got some help courtesy of Jaelyn Spangler, who scored ten points along with two steals.
Logan/Palco's defeat dropped their record down to 2-6. As for Western Plains, their defeat dropped their record down to 1-6.
